What are 60-Second Instagram Stories?
So, what's the big deal about 60-second Instagram Stories? Previously, Instagram divided longer videos into 15-second segments, which could disrupt the flow and impact viewer engagement. Now, with the extended time limit, you can post uninterrupted videos up to a minute long. This means no more awkward pauses or abrupt cuts in your stories. It’s a game-changer, especially for tutorials, behind-the-scenes content, and mini-vlogs. For businesses, this is an incredible opportunity to showcase products, share customer testimonials, or give a more comprehensive look at their brand narrative.
Imagine you're a chef showcasing a quick recipe. Instead of breaking it down into four 15-second clips, you can seamlessly walk your audience through the entire process in one go. Or, if you're a musician, you can share a longer snippet of your new song without the choppy interruptions. The possibilities are endless! How to Use 60-Second Stories Effectively
To make the most of 60-second Instagram Stories, it's important to approach them strategically. Here are some tips to help you create engaging and effective content:
Plan Your Content: Before you start recording, take some time to plan out your story. What message do you want to convey? What visuals will you use? A little preparation can go a long way in ensuring that your story is coherent and engaging.
Optimize for Mobile Viewing: Keep in mind that most people will be watching your story on their mobile devices. Use clear and concise language, and make sure your visuals are easy to see on a small screen.
Use Captions and Text Overlays: Captions and text overlays can help you convey your message even when viewers have their sound turned off. They can also add context and highlight key points.
Incorporate Interactive Elements: Use polls, quizzes, and question stickers to encourage viewer participation. Interactive elements can boost engagement and make your stories more fun and memorable.
Maintain High-Quality Visuals: Ensure your videos are well-lit and in focus. Use high-resolution images and graphics to create a visually appealing experience. Blurry or pixelated visuals can turn viewers off.
Tell a Story: Even though you have 60 seconds, it's still important to tell a compelling story. Use a clear beginning, middle, and end to keep viewers engaged from start to finish.
